How do you write a dissertation research proposal?

A dissertation proposal should generally include:An introduction to your topic and aims.A literature review of the current state of knowledge.An outline of your proposed methodology.A discussion of the possible implications of the research.A bibliography of relevant sources.

What is a research proposal dissertation?

Dissertation proposals are like the table of contents for your research, and will help you explain what it is you intend to examine, and roughly, how you intend to go about collecting and analysing your data.

What is a formal research proposal?

A research proposal is a concise and coherent summary of your proposed research. It sets out the central issues or questions that you intend to address. It also demonstrates the originality of your proposed research. The proposal is the most important document that you submit as part of the application process.
